A Guide to Software Development Cost Breakdown in UK in 2024

In today’s tech-driven era, custom software development has become the cornerstone of innovation and efficiency for businesses across various industries. However, one of the most crucial aspects that every business owner or entrepreneur considers before embarking on a custom software development journey is the cost involved. In this comprehensive guide, we’ll delve into the intricacies of software development cost breakdown in 2024, shedding light on what factors influence these costs and how businesses can make informed decisions. Whether you’re in London, the UK, or anywhere else globally, understanding these dynamics is essential for navigating the landscape of custom software development.

Understanding Custom Software Development

Custom software development refers to the process of creating tailored software solutions that cater specifically to the unique needs and requirements of a business. Unlike off-the-shelf solutions, custom software offers unparalleled flexibility, scalability, and efficiency. This level of customization ensures that businesses can streamline their operations, enhance productivity, and achieve their goals effectively. As a leading mobile app development company in London, we’ve witnessed firsthand the transformative power of custom software solutions for businesses across various sectors.

Factors Influencing the Cost of Custom Software Development

Complexity of the App

The complexity of the app plays a pivotal role in determining the overall development cost. Apps can range from simple ones with basic features to moderate and highly complex applications that require advanced functionalities and integrations. For instance, an e-commerce app may fall under the moderate complexity category, while a healthcare app with real-time data analytics would be considered highly complex.

Platform Compatibility

Choosing the right platform for your app development also impacts costs. Whether it’s iOS, Android, Web, or cross-platform development, each platform comes with its set of requirements and development nuances. As a reputable mobile app development company in the UK, we advise clients on the best platform options based on their target audience, budget, and scalability needs.

Design and User Experience (UX/UI)

Investing in intuitive design and user-friendly interfaces is paramount for the success of any app. Custom designs, animations, and seamless user experiences contribute significantly to development costs but are crucial for attracting and retaining users.

Integration with Third-Party Services

Integrating third-party services such as payment gateways, analytics tools, or APIs adds another layer of complexity to the development process. These integrations enhance app functionality but also incur additional costs.

Cost Breakdown of Custom Software Development

When it comes to the cost breakdown of custom software development, several key factors come into play:

Development Team Expenses

Hiring an in-house team versus outsourcing can significantly impact costs. Expenses related to developers, designers, testers, and project managers contribute to the overall budget.

Technology Stack

The choice of programming languages, frameworks, and tools influences costs. Additionally, licensing fees for proprietary software must be considered.

Project Management and Testing

Investing in robust project management tools, quality assurance, and testing processes ensures a smooth development cycle but adds to the overall expenses.

Average Costs in 2024 for Custom Software Development

As a custom software development company, we understand the importance of transparency when it comes to costs. On average, the cost of developing custom software in 2024 varies based on the type of application and its complexity. For example:

– E-commerce apps: £15,000 – £50,000
– Social media apps: £40,000 – £100,000
– Healthcare apps: £100,000 – £150,000
– Enterprise solutions: £150,000 and above

These cost ranges are indicative and can vary based on specific project requirements.

Tips for Cost-Effective Custom Software Development

To optimize costs without compromising on quality, businesses can:
– Prioritize features based on the Minimum Viable Product (MVP) approach.
– Optimize resource allocation and team collaboration.
– Consider scalability and future maintenance costs during the development phase.

Case Studies and Real-Life Examples

Highlighting successful custom software development projects and their cost structures can provide valuable insights for businesses. These case studies showcase how strategic planning and budget allocation lead to successful outcomes.

Conclusion

In conclusion, understanding the cost breakdown of software development in 2024 is essential for businesses looking to leverage technology for growth and innovation. As a trusted mobile app development company in London and the UK, we empower businesses to make informed decisions, navigate the complexities of custom software development, and achieve their digital transformation goals effectively. Partnering with a reputable custom software development services company ensures a seamless development journey tailored to your unique business needs and budget constraints.